Amplitude death has been intensively investigated in the field of nonlinear science for almost 40 years. In the present article, we review the use of analytical tools for robust stability/control, which have been provided in the field of system control, to obtain the conditions under which amplitude death occurs when the number of oscillators and the network topologies are unknown. Specifically, we explain our results for two representative couplings for inducing amplitude death, dynamical coupling and delayed coupling.
